The new NWW Shipwreck Radio 2cd is staggering. Potter/Stapleton basically dropped off on arctic circle isle north of Norway -- no instruments, just minimal tools to recycle the sounds of the fishermen, birds etc. into hallucinatory mindfuck then rebroadcast over the island's radio station to freaked out residents daily. There's one heavy-rain segment seguing into a loop of a foreign-tongue babbling child that is just amazing.
